Made for people paid by the hour

Salaried employees see one steady figure each month, but for hourly workers, income can vary with every shift, every overtime hour, and every bonus. The wage calculators in this category are built for that reality, helping you turn an hourly rate into a clear picture of what you earn across a week, a month, and a year, and showing how extra hours and bonuses add up.

From hourly rate to full salary

An hourly rate on its own tells you little about your standard of living. The hourly wage calculator converts it into weekly, monthly, and annual equivalents based on the hours you actually work, so you can compare an hourly job against a salaried one on equal footing and understand exactly what your time is worth.

Getting overtime right

Overtime is where many workers lose out simply because they do not check the math. Time-and-a-half, double-time, and different rates for weekends or holidays can make overtime significantly more valuable than regular hours, but only if it is calculated correctly. The overtime calculator applies the right multiplier so you can confirm your extra hours are paid in full.

What a bonus is really worth

A bonus always sounds generous, but tax and deductions can take a substantial bite before it reaches you. The bonus calculator estimates the net amount you will actually receive, so a headline figure never misleads you and you can plan around the real number rather than the gross promise.

Know your worth

When you understand exactly how your hours, overtime, and bonuses translate into take-home pay, you are far better placed to manage your money, spot payroll errors, and make the case for better pay.
